Lucky Heaven Review
It's not very often that you find an online slot with a solo payline, but that's exactly the case in Lady Luck Games' Lucky Heaven. This oriental slot plays on 3-reels with a solo payline meaning that you have to land a winning combination of 3 of the same symbols on 1 line.
Alongside this simplistic gameplay, you'll notice that the visuals are inspired by the beauty of Chinese culture. Additionally, you'll find that there are 3 levels leading to multipliers when you land a winning combination and climb up. Design
The entire slot is set in the clouds with various Bonzai trees surrounding the central hub. There are mountains in the distance and the reels are centred in a Chinese looking house with lanterns and pagoda roofs with a green colour scheme.
However, when you go up in levels, the quality improves with the second level having cherry blossom trees along with castles in the distance and pastels colours around the reels. Each level gets more impressive and adds more symbols to the reels.
As for the music, there's an oriental score in the distance with stringed instruments mixed with woodwind sounds to make something magical and epic. It gets more intense as you climb up the levels but retains a wonderful quality.
Gameplay
There's not a whole lot to the gameplay of Lucky Heaven as there is only 1 payline. As you land wins, you'll climb up levels to gain multipliers and that's about it for the gameplay.
In terms of the menus, you'll find the spin button, bet level and additional information at the bottom left of the screen.
Win Potential
Sadly, this slot starts off with a low RTP of 95.55% which is under the average standard but thankfully not ridiculously low. As for volatility, this slot has a high volatility level meaning that you'll often find that the wins are higher but at a less frequent rate.
When it comes to the maximum win, we found that the maximum seemed to be 400x your stake which can be achieved through multipliers in the different levels. This isn't anything spectacular and may put off some players as it's low compared to other online slots.
Our Verdict
Lucky Heaven is a strange online slot and may not appeal to all types of players. There is a definite lack of features in this slot but it seems deliberate to focus on the core elements of the gameplay and the overall design.
